接口测试用例模板大全:10个实用技巧提升测试效率

接口测试用例模板的重要性和应用

在软件开发过程中,接口测试用例模板扮演着至关重要的角色。它不仅能确保接口功能的正确性,还能提高测试效率,降低bug出现的概率。本文将深入探讨接口测试用例模板的重要性,并为您提供10个实用技巧,帮助您提升测试效率。

接口测试用例模板的基本结构

一个优秀的接口测试用例模板通常包含以下几个关键要素:

1. 测试用例ID:用于唯一标识每个测试用例。

2. 测试目的:明确说明该测试用例的目标。

3. 前置条件:描述执行测试用例所需的环境和条件。

4. 输入数据:详细列出测试所需的输入参数。

5. 预期结果:明确说明预期的测试输出。

6. 实际结果:记录测试执行后的实际输出。

7. 测试步骤:详细描述测试的执行过程。

8. 测试状态:标明测试用例的执行状态(如通过、失败、阻塞等)。

9. 备注:添加额外的说明或注意事项。

提升测试效率的10个实用技巧

1. 使用标准化模板:采用统一的接口测试用例模板可以提高团队协作效率,减少沟通成本。可以考虑使用ONES研发管理平台来管理和共享标准化的测试用例模板。

2. 参数化测试数据:将测试数据从测试用例中分离出来,使用参数化的方式进行测试,可以大大提高测试的覆盖率和效率。

3. 自动化测试:对于重复性高的测试用例,可以考虑使用自动化测试工具,如Postman、JMeter等,提高测试执行效率。

4. 优先级分类:根据接口的重要程度和风险级别,对测试用例进行优先级分类,确保关键接口得到充分测试。

5. 边界值测试:在设计测试用例时,注重边界值和异常情况的测试,这些往往是容易出现问题的地方。

6. 数据驱动测试:采用数据驱动的方式,可以用同一个测试用例模板测试多组不同的数据,提高测试效率。

7. 测试用例复用:对于类似的接口,可以复用已有的测试用例模板,只需要修改部分参数即可,避免重复工作。

8. 持续集成:将接口测试集成到持续集成流程中,可以及时发现和解决问题,提高开发效率。ONES研发管理平台提供了与主流CI/CD工具的集成,可以方便地实现这一点。

9. 测试环境管理:使用专门的测试环境管理工具,确保测试环境的稳定性和一致性,减少由环境问题导致的测试失败。

10. 测试结果分析:使用测试结果分析工具,快速定位问题,提高问题解决效率。ONES研发管理平台提供了强大的测试结果分析功能,可以帮助团队更好地理解和改进测试过程。

接口测试用例模板

接口测试用例模板的最佳实践

除了上述技巧,在使用接口测试用例模板时,还应注意以下最佳实践:

1. 保持简洁明了:测试用例描述应简洁清晰,避免冗长复杂的描述。

2. 注重可重复性:确保测试用例可以被其他测试人员轻松理解和执行。

3. 及时更新维护:随着接口的变化,及时更新和维护测试用例模板。

4. 关注安全性测试:在设计测试用例时,不要忽视接口的安全性测试,如认证、授权等方面。

5. 考虑性能测试:在接口测试用例模板中,适当加入性能测试相关的内容,如响应时间、并发处理能力等。

结语

接口测试用例模板是保证软件质量的重要工具。通过使用标准化的模板和采用上述提升效率的技巧,可以显著提高测试的效率和质量。在实际应用中,可以根据项目的具体需求,灵活调整和优化接口测试用例模板。记住,一个好的测试用例模板不仅能提高测试效率,还能帮助团队更好地理解和改进开发过程。持续优化和改进您的接口测试用例模板,将为您的项目质量带来长期的收益。